The Rise of the American Chestnut

In the 19th and early 20th centuries, the American chestnut tree was an integral part of the Appalachian forests. Spanning from Maine to Georgia, it covered nearly 200 million acres of woodland. Its nuts were a staple food for many animals, including bears, deer, and squirrels. People also relied on chestnuts for their livelihoods, selling them in markets during the fall. The tree’s rapid growth and ability to reach heights of over 100 feet made it a dominant species in its habitat. Its presence was so pronounced that it was often referred to as the “Redwood of the East.”

The Arrival of the Chestnut Blight Fungus

The downfall of the American chestnut began with the introduction of the chestnut blight fungus, known scientifically as *Cryphonectria parasitica*. This pathogen originated in Asia and was accidentally introduced to North America in the early 1900s through imported nursery stock. The fungus spread rapidly, infecting trees by entering through wounds in the bark. It produced cankers that girdled the tree, cutting off nutrients and leading to its eventual death. Within a few decades, the blight had decimated the American chestnut population.

The Impact on Forest Ecosystems

The loss of the American chestnut had profound effects on forest ecosystems. As a keystone species, its demise disrupted food chains and altered habitats. Wildlife that depended on chestnuts for sustenance had to adapt or face population declines. Other tree species, such as oaks and maples, filled the void left by the chestnuts, but they could not fully replace the ecological functions provided by the chestnut. The forest composition changed, impacting biodiversity and the overall health of the ecosystem.

Economic and Cultural Consequences

The extinction of the American chestnut tree also had significant economic and cultural repercussions. The timber industry suffered as the supply of high-quality chestnut wood dwindled. Communities that relied on chestnut harvests for income faced economic hardships. Culturally, the loss was deeply felt, as chestnuts were a beloved part of holiday traditions and local folklore. The disappearance of the American chestnut was not just an environmental tragedy but a blow to the cultural identity of many rural communities.

Efforts to Revive the American Chestnut

Despite the devastation, efforts to resurrect the American chestnut have been underway for decades. Scientists and conservationists have been working tirelessly to develop blight-resistant trees through breeding programs and genetic engineering. By crossbreeding the American chestnut with its Asian relatives, researchers aim to introduce resistance genes while preserving the tree’s original characteristics. These efforts are a testament to human ingenuity and determination to restore a lost natural treasure.

Genetic Engineering: A Glimmer of Hope

Recent advancements in genetic engineering offer new hope for the American chestnut’s revival. Researchers have successfully inserted a gene from wheat into the chestnut’s genome, which helps the tree resist the blight fungus. This genetically modified chestnut tree shows promise for reintroduction into the wild, where it could potentially restore its place in the ecosystem. While there are ethical and regulatory hurdles to overcome, the potential benefits of this approach are undeniable.

Challenges in Restoration Efforts

While progress has been made, the path to restoring the American chestnut is fraught with challenges. Ensuring genetic diversity in the reintroduced population is crucial to avoid the pitfalls of monoculture. There is also the risk of unintended ecological consequences, such as the impact on other species and the potential for the modified trees to spread beyond intended areas. Additionally, public perception and acceptance of genetically modified organisms (GMOs) play a significant role in the success of these efforts.
